Carmen Herrera — Negro y Naranja (Black and Orange)
Carmen Herrera

Negro y Naranja (Black and Orange)

"Negro y Naranja" demonstrates Carmen Herrera's characteristic exploration of color relationships and geometric abstraction through the lithographic medium. The composition features bold blocks of black and orange that interact dynamically across the BFK Rives paper, exemplifying her modernist approach to form and chromatic contrast. Created as a color lithograph, the work reflects Herrera's commitment to investigating how pure colors and simplified shapes can generate visual tension and spatial complexity.

Medium
Lithograph in colours, on BFK Rives paper, with full margins.
